		<title>COVID-19 associated hyperthyroidism due to destructive thyrotoxicosis in a young female patient</title>
		<pubDate>07/27/2020</pubDate>
		<link>https://www.theskygallerypattaya.com/hcem/acem-aid1016.php</link>
		<description>&amp;lt;h2&amp;gt;Abstract&amp;lt;/h2&amp;gt;

&amp;lt;p&amp;gt;SARS-CoV2 can induce multiple immunological and endocrinological changes. We report the case of a COVID-19 associated hyperthyroidism in a young female.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;Per definition the patient &amp;amp;ndash; because of having given birth six weeks previously - had a postpartum thyroiditis. However thus no antibodies were detected, the thyroiditis ceased without medication after the dissolving of the virus disease and the fT3/fT3-ratio proved a destructive thyreopathy as well as there was a close time link onset of the symptoms with the novel corona virus infection we argue it to be a COVID-19 induced thyrotoxicosis.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;This proves the ability of SARS-CoV-2 to alter thyroid function, therefore all COVID-19 patients should be monitored regarding endocrinological changes and TSH, fT3, fT4 should be assessed.&amp;lt;/p&amp;gt;</description>

		<title>Diagnostic imaging in congenital adrenal hyperplasia â€“ how does it help?</title>
		<pubDate>04/29/2020</pubDate>
		<link>https://www.theskygallerypattaya.com/hcem/acem-aid1013.php</link>
		<description>&amp;lt;h2&amp;gt;Summary&amp;lt;/h2&amp;gt;

&amp;lt;p&amp;gt;The phenotypic manifestation of congenital adrenal hyperplasia (CAH) is variable, and this largely depends on the extent of 21-Hydroxylase enzyme deficiency. In non- classic CAH (NCCAH), the clinical features predominantly reflect the androgen excess rather than adrenal insufficiency. In boys, the condition may not present until much later in childhood, where the diagnosis is made following presentation with precocious puberty, features of aldosterone insufficiency, or this condition may be detected during fertility workup.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;Imaging is generally not used in the evaluation of CAH, but may be helpful for the diagnosis, management, and follow-up of these patients. CAH can result in adrenal enlargement in both classic and non-classic forms of adrenal hyperplasia. The so-called adrenal rest tissue may be seen at several sites throughout the body, including the celiac plexus region, broad ligaments, normal ovaries, and testes. Sustained elevation of adrenocorticotropic hormone (ACTH) in patients with CAH has been postulated to cause adrenal rest cells to grow and become functionally active. The discovery of bilateral adrenal enlargement during radiologic evaluation for unrelated disease processes might serve as a mode of presentation for clinically not apparent or non- classical congenital adrenal hyperplasia (NCCAH).&amp;lt;/p&amp;gt;</description>

		<title>Endocrine abnormalities in two siblings with Rothmund Thomson Syndrome</title>
		<pubDate>10/11/2018</pubDate>
		<link>https://www.theskygallerypattaya.com/hcem/acem-aid1010.php</link>
		<description>&amp;lt;h2&amp;gt;Abstract&amp;lt;/h2&amp;gt;

&amp;lt;p&amp;gt;Rothmund-Thomson syndrome is a rare autosomal recessive disorder characterized by poikiloderma (skin atrophy, telangiectasia, hyper- and hypopigmentation), congenital skeletal abnormalities, short stature, premature aging, and increased risk of malignant disease. Two siblings with Rothmund-Thomson Syndrome showed the following characteristic features: severe growth failure, dystrophic nails, absent eyelashes/eyebrows, small hands, clinodactyly, microdontia and congential poikiloderma. In addition, delayed sexual development with cryptorchidism in the male and Hashimato thyroiditis in the female patient were detected. These cases are presented here because of these endocrine patterns, with the aim of drawing attention to the invisible aspects of Rothmund-Thomson syndrome.&amp;lt;/p&amp;gt;</description>

		<title>Comparison of Efficacy and Safety of Hydroxychloroquine and Teneligliptin in Type 2 Diabetes Patients who are Inadequately Controlled with Glimepiride, Metformin and Insulin therapy: A Randomized Controlled Trial with Parallel Group Design</title>
		<pubDate>09/13/2018</pubDate>
		<link>https://www.theskygallerypattaya.com/hcem/acem-aid1009.php</link>
		<description>&amp;lt;h2&amp;gt;Abstract&amp;lt;/h2&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Aim:&amp;lt;/strong&amp;gt; The aim of the present study is to assess the efficacy and safety of Hydroxychloroquine in comparison with Teneligliptin in type 2 diabetes patients whose blood glucose levels were inadequately controlled with metformin, Glimepiride and insulin therapy.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Methods:&amp;lt;/strong&amp;gt; This was a randomized, prospective, parallel-group, experimental trial done in 300 Type 2 Diabetes patients who were uncontrolled (HbA1c=7.5&amp;amp;ndash;10%) with metformin, Glimepiride and insulin therapy. Patients were randomly divided into two groups one received Teneligliptin 20 mg (n=152) and other received Hydroxychloroquine 400 mg (n=148) while continuing insulin therapy with other 2 OHA. Insulin doses were adjusted to maintain normal blood glucose levels.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Result: &amp;lt;/strong&amp;gt;The adjusted mean change from baseline to endpoint in HbA1c was &amp;amp;minus;1.2&amp;amp;plusmn;0.5% in patient group receiving Hydroxychloroquine and &amp;amp;minus;0.9&amp;amp;plusmn;0.5% in patients group receiving Teneligliptin, respectively, with a significant between-treatment difference (p&amp;amp;lt;0.001). The incidence of adverse events was similar in the Hydroxychloroquine (72%) and Teneligliptin (77%) groups. However, hypoglycaemic events were less common (p&amp;amp;lt;0.001) and less severe (p&amp;amp;lt;0.05) in patients receiving Hydroxychloroquine than in those receiving Teneligliptin.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Conclusion: &amp;lt;/strong&amp;gt;Hydroxychloroquine decreases HbA1c in patients whose type 2 diabetes is poorly controlled with high doses of insulin as compare to Teneligliptin. Addition of hydroxychloroquine to insulin therapy is also associated with reduced incidence of confirmed and severe hypoglycaemia.&amp;lt;/p&amp;gt;</description>

		<title>Exercise preserves pancreatic Î²-cell mass and function in obese OLETF rats</title>
		<pubDate>06/19/2018</pubDate>
		<link>https://www.theskygallerypattaya.com/hcem/acem-aid1007.php</link>
		<description>&amp;lt;h2&amp;gt;Abstract&amp;lt;/h2&amp;gt;

&amp;lt;p&amp;gt;Although exercise has been proposed to be beneficial to type 2 diabetes, its effects on &amp;amp;beta;-cell function and mass remain unclear. In the present study, the effects of long-term swimming training on the function and mass of &amp;amp;beta;-cells in diabetic OLETF rats were examined. At 44 weeks of age after developing diabetes, the OLETF rats were divided into two groups: a control group and an exercise group. The exercise group had a daily swimming for 12 weeks. While not found with the control rats, in the obese OLETF rats, the exercise reduced the weight gain which was associated with improved glucose tolerance and elevated circulating insulin levels as determined by the oral glucose tolerance test and insulin ELISA. The exercise improved plasma total cholesterol and triglyceride levels, and also significantly increased the islet &amp;amp;beta;-cell mass and pancreatic insulin content associated with decreased &amp;amp;beta;-cell apoptosis and elevated activation of the serine/threonine kinase, Akt. The present studies suggest that exercise improves diabetes symptoms via enhancement of the &amp;amp;beta;-cell mass and function through decreasing glucolipotoxicity and reducing &amp;amp;beta;-cell apoptosis by activating Akt in obese OLETF rats.&amp;lt;/p&amp;gt;</description>

		<title>Parathyroid Functions in Thalassemia Major Patients</title>
		<pubDate>08/29/2017</pubDate>
		<link>https://www.theskygallerypattaya.com/hcem/acem-aid1003.php</link>
		<description>&amp;lt;h2&amp;gt;Abstract&amp;lt;/h2&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Background:&amp;lt;/strong&amp;gt; Hypoparathyroidism is well known to occur in thalassemia major patients, but it is thought to be uncommon and its incidence is considered to be decreasing with improvements in chelation therapy. The objective of this study was to assess the prevalence of parathyroid dysfunction in the first decade of life of the patients with thalassemia major.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Patients and Methods:&amp;lt;/strong&amp;gt; Ninety children with beta-thalassemia major (55 males and 35 females) with a mean age of 7.17&amp;amp;plusmn;3.78 years (1-13 years) and age and sex matched control group of 60 healthy children (36 males and 24 females) with a mean age 6.98&amp;amp;plusmn;3.66 years (1-13) years. Serum parathyroid hormone (PTH), serum total Calcium (Ca), serum phosphorus (P), serum alkaline phosphatase (ALP), serum 25-hydroxyvitamin D (25-OHD) and serum ferritin levels were measured.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Result:&amp;lt;/strong&amp;gt; PTH levels were higher than normal range in 23 (25.6%) patients with a mean value of 75.2&amp;amp;plusmn;31.3 &amp;amp;micro;g/mL compared to those having normal range level (35.3&amp;amp;plusmn;15.2 &amp;amp;micro;g/mL). Ca levels were found low in 11 patients (12.2%), and P levels were found high in 2 (2.22%) and low in 4 (4.44%) patients while high ALP levels were found in 6 (6.67%) patients. 25-OHD levels were low in all patients with a mean value of 24.95&amp;amp;plusmn;5.82.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Conclusion:&amp;lt;/strong&amp;gt; Reports in the literature indicate that parathyroid dysfunction due to iron overload generally occurs in 2nd or 3rd decade of patients with thalassemia major. However, our study shows that PTH due to iron overload may develop in a significant number of thalassemia major patients, therefore, all thalassemics should be carefully watched for endocrine organ function such as hyperparathyroidism might occur even in the first decade of the patients with thalassemia major.&amp;lt;/p&amp;gt;</description>

		<title>Effect on Vitamin D status of Breastfeeding Infants after Vitamin D3 Supplementation during Breastfeeding Lactation: A double-blind randomized controlled trial</title>
		<pubDate>08/04/2017</pubDate>
		<link>https://www.theskygallerypattaya.com/hcem/acem-aid1002.php</link>
		<description>&amp;lt;h2&amp;gt;Abstract&amp;lt;/h2&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Background:&amp;lt;/strong&amp;gt; Vitamin D deficiency in pregnancy increases several risks of breastfed mothers. To prevent these adverse events, vitamin D supplementation during pregnancy and lactation is recommended, but suggested dose ranges vary.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Objective:&amp;lt;/strong&amp;gt; To determine whether vitamin D3 1,800 IU/d supplementation in lactating mothers improves the vitamin D status of their breastfed infants.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Materials and Methods:&amp;lt;/strong&amp;gt; A randomized, placebo&amp;amp;ndash;controlled trial with Thai pregnant women was conducted. Lactating mothers (n=72) and their breastfed infants with insufficient maternal 25 hydroxyvitamin D (25(OH)D) levels in the third trimester were randomly assigned to two groups, one of which received 1,800 IU/d vitamin D supplementation and the other a placebo. Maternal serum 25(OH)D during lactation, cord blood, and 6-week breastfed infant serum were measured using LC-MS/MS.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Results: &amp;lt;/strong&amp;gt;Mean maternal age (&amp;amp;plusmn;SD) was 27&amp;amp;plusmn;5 years, and pre-gestational BMI was 22.29&amp;amp;plusmn;5 kg/m2. Maternal serum 25(OH)D at baseline was 22.29&amp;amp;plusmn;7.15 nmol/L. At 6 weeks, both maternal 25(OH)D and infant 25 (OH)D levels had increased significantly in the vitamin D supplement group of mothers and infants (68.30&amp;amp;plusmn;15.40, 40.40&amp;amp;plusmn;12.56 nmol/L) compared to those in placebo groups (55.15&amp;amp;plusmn;13.57, 24.28&amp;amp;plusmn;17.20 nmol/L) (p &amp;amp;lt;0.001, p&amp;amp;lt;0.001). The changes in infant 25(OH)D levels increased substantially in the vitamin D supplement group but decreased in placebo(17.49&amp;amp;plusmn;16.27 ng/ml compared to -1.34&amp;amp;plusmn;19.23 nmol/L in the placebo group, p&amp;amp;lt;0.001). The change of maternal 25(OH)D were positively correlation to the change of 25(OH)D level in breastmilk mothers and infants by r=0.697, p&amp;amp;lt;0.001 and r=0.379, p=0.003 respectively.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Conclusions: &amp;lt;/strong&amp;gt;Vitamin D3 supplementation to breastfed mother during lactation can increase serum 25(OH)D level in Thai breastfed mother and infants. Further work is needed to determine the optimum duration of vitamin D supplementation to normalized breastfed infants with 25(OH)D level &amp;amp;gt;75 nmol/L.&amp;lt;/p&amp;gt;</description>

		<title>Recurrent Cardiac Events Driven by Prothrombotic Burden in a Patient Undergoing Lipoprotein Apheresis for High Lp(a) Levels</title>
		<pubDate>03/15/2017</pubDate>
		<link>https://www.theskygallerypattaya.com/hcem/acem-aid1001.php</link>
		<description>&amp;lt;h2&amp;gt;Abstract&amp;lt;/h2&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Introduction:&amp;lt;/strong&amp;gt; Lipoprotein (a) [Lp(a)] is a marker for cardiovascular disease, involved in pathogenesis and progression of atherosclerosis. In selected high-risk patients, lipoprotein-apheresis could optimize secondary prevention and improve prognosis.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Aim:&amp;lt;/strong&amp;gt; We presented the case of a 49-year-old man with high lipoprotein (a) levels and recurrent cardiac adverse events, despite maximal pharmacological therapy.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Case report:&amp;lt;/strong&amp;gt; Four years before the admission at our Centre, he presented an anterior STEMI, treated with angioplasty and implantation of a drug eluting stent on left anterior descending artery, at the age of 47 years, in September 2012; one month later, the patients presented a new episode of angina, and exams showed a critical stenosis in the right coronary artery, treated by angioplasty and implantation of drug eluting stent. Because of high Lp(a) plasma levels, patient was subsequently on regularly 7-10 day lipoprotein apheresis.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Results and discussion:&amp;lt;/strong&amp;gt; A thrombophilic screening was performed, showing the simultaneous presence of heterozygous V Leiden mutation and prothrombin G20210A mutation. He referred to our Centre in order to optimize therapy; we performed an endothelial function assessment showing a severe dysfunctional pattern.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;Because of these findings, we prescribed dual antiplatelet therapy, and we added omega-3 fatty acids and association with nicotinic acid/laropiprant. According with current guidelines, considering the high risk of bleeding, we preferred not to administer anticoagulant therapy. At 6-month and 1-year follow up the patient continued lipoprotein apheresis and was asymptomatic for other cardiovascular events.&amp;lt;/p&amp;gt;

&amp;lt;p&amp;gt;&amp;lt;strong&amp;gt;Conclusions:&amp;lt;/strong&amp;gt; The assessment for the eventual presence of thrombophilia might become a useful tool in clinical practice for high-risk selected patients.&amp;lt;/p&amp;gt;</description>
